This new Reebok Pump Omni Lite is crafted in the same pattern that defined the most recent drop, but you might not recognize that thanks to their different implementations. The earlier Steel/Shark edition fit firmly in the ‘tonal’ category thanks to its mix of greys and a white sole. This new black and royal edition utilizes the exact same template, but thanks to the definitive black/white split and a blue slice through the heel, these come off quite differently.
